This car has never had a problem making power. Putting it down has been the issue. They set the ET record at 7.xx a couple years back with several hundred less HP. They've been increasing the MPH record hand over fist and haven't been able to better their ET. I think they are at 213mph in the 1/4 now.

Insane car.

I seriously don't even understand how an AWD trans can take a launch at 1600 whtq. lol Maybe that's the problem ... I can't see the video, but if they are not able to take advantage of the power at launch, the ET is going to be hard to improve on at that level. I mean it might take a hundred more WHP to knock off a tenth in ET at those levels.
